Husband of Hong Kong actress Myolie Wu denies infidelity rumours, says he's a 'big hugger'
He added that photo angles can be misleading.
Hong Kong actress Myolie Wu's husband, Philip Lee, has denied rumors of infidelity after photos surfaced of him hugging several women at a club on Mar. 18.
In an Instagram post on Mar. 19, the businessman wrote: "Hug all your family, friends and colleagues! Long sincere hugs. Both men and women, boyfriends and girlfriends! Husbands and wives!"
"Just like I did for my birthday in a lounge bar because that's where many people have birthday drinks with a few of their close family, friends and colleagues. And I would do it all over again, because anyone who knows me well also knows I'm a big hugger."
Wu also liked the post.
The couple have been married since 2015 and have three sons together.

Photos showing Lee acting intimately with several women began circulating on Chinese social media on Mar. 18.
Hong Kong tabloid East Week reported that Lee was celebrating his 52nd birthday at a bar, where he was seen repeatedly hugging and kissing several women.
Wu was reportedly not present at the celebration.
Photo angles misleading
In his post, Lee clarified that the angles of the photos can be "very misleading".
"Might even make you look like you're doing something you're not," he added.
